Present plan is to have Terminator Inq & his unit of Terms to be in reserve/deepstrike ready to come in on turn 2 possibly rapid ingress and get them into position to utilize their special weapons but use clandestine to give the 2 subductor squads & the Agents blob infilitrate and move them into midground behind cover so that I can move them up or hold their position. Use this to get early control. Further the RTE & Breachers infiltrate as well using the backroom deals ability (picking up Landers when I go to higher points). Agents blob hopefully will be a rather nasty blob for someone to deal with since it'll have a 5+ Invul from the daemonhosts and all those nice weapons from the agents themselves - figure I make them a bit of a mid-board problem for the opponent to deal with hopefully as a surprise since they might not expect a unit like that to put out so much and handle incoming.
From there the Voidsmen stay back to secure back object. and the last unit of Vigilant to move up the board and prepare to assist where ever or do clean up work in later rounds.
I think it is a biiit of an aggressive play to have it all up front, but I do tend to play that way.
